Automation Engineering competencies

1 Electrotechnical and other basic competence

A Bachelor of Engineering: applies mathematical methods and tools to describe field-related phenomena and to solve problems
- understands the laws of physics significant to the field, especially with regard to electromagnetic phenomena
- has knowledge of the components of electromagnetism and basic connections for automation, electrical and mechanical technology
- has command of the basic measurements of electrotechnology
- has command of basic ICT skills.

2 Design competence

A Bachelor of Engineering:
- knows the methods and tools of hardware and software design in automation
- is competent in dimensioning and selecting devices and components using techno-economic principles
- is able to produce standardized documentation and has an ability to apply 3D modelling in designing
- understands the significance of standards and is able to use them in all steps of designing
- understands the key concepts of quality systems.

5 Competence of basic circuits

A Bachelor of Engineering:
- is able to design circuits for measurement, control, valves and motors
- knows the theory of conventional feedback control circuit
- is able to perform process experiments, draw basic models for process dynamics and to use PID control circuit tuning methods
- is able to implement measurement, control, valve and motor circuits on the software and hardware level.

6 Competence in processes, machines and systems

A Bachelor of Engineering:
- has knowledge of the typical production processes and machinery
- can use the essential sensors, transmitters and regulating units used in various processes
- knows the structure and maintenance of control systems
- is able to implement control applications using programmable logic and process control systems
- has command of the HW and SW designing of automation systems from the definition to the implementation.
